+/**
+@publishedAll
+@released
+
+Client class to access Audio Play Device functionality.
+
+The class uses the custom command function of the controller plugin, and removes the necessity
+for the client to formulate the custom commands.
+@since 7.0s
+*/
+class RMMFAudioPlayDeviceCustomCommands : public RMMFCustomCommandsBase
+	{
+public:
+
+	/**
+	Constructor.
+
+	@param  aController
+	        The client side controller object to be used by this custom command interface.
+
+	@since 7.0s
+	*/
+	IMPORT_C RMMFAudioPlayDeviceCustomCommands(RMMFController& aController);
+
+	/**
+	Sets the volume of the sound device.
+
+	@param  aVolume
+	        The new volume.
+
+	@return	One of the system-wide error codes.
+
+	@since 7.0s
+	*/
+	IMPORT_C TInt SetVolume(TInt aVolume) const;
+
+	/**
+	Gets the maximum volume supported by the sound device.
+
+	@param  aMaxVolume
+	        The maximum volume, filled in by the controller.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t GetMaxVolume(TInt& aMaxVolume) const;
+
+	/**
+	Gets the current playback volume.
+
+	@param  aVolume
+	        On return contains the current playback volume.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t GetVolume(TInt& aVolume) const;
+
+	/**
+	Sets a volume ramp.
+
+	This will cause the sound device to start playing with zero volume,
+	increasing the volume over aRampDuration microseconds.
+
+	The volume ramp can be removed by setting the ramp duration to zero.
+
+	@param  aRampDuration
+	        The duration over which the volume is to be increased, in microseconds.
+
+	@return One of the system-wide error codes.
+
+	@since 7.0s
+	*/
+	IMPORT_C TInt SetVolumeRamp(const TTimeIntervalMicroSeconds& aRampDuration) const;
+
+	/**
+	Sets the balance between the left and right stereo audio channels.
+
+	@param  aBalance
+	        Use a value between KMMFBalanceMaxLeft and KMMFBalanceMaxRight. Centre balance can be
+	        restored by using KMMFBalanceCenter.
+
+	@return	One of the system-wide error codes.
+
+	@since 7.0s
+	*/
+	IMPORT_C TInt SetBalance(TInt aBalance) const;
+
+	/**
+	Gets the balance between the left and right stereo audio channels.
+
+	@param  aBalance
+	        The current balance, filled in by the controller.
+
+	@return One of the system-wide error codes.
+	
+	@since 7.0s
+	*/
+	IMPORT_C TInt GetBalance(TInt& aBalance) const;
+	};

+/**
+@publishedAll
+@released
+
+Custom command parser class to be used by controller plugins wishing to support
+audio play device commands.
+
+The controller plugin must be derived from MMMFAudioPlayDeviceCustomCommandImplementor
+to use this class.
+
+The controller plugin should create an object of this type and add it to the list of custom
+command parsers in the controller framework. See the following example code for details.
+
+@code
+void CMMFAudioController::ConstructL()
+	{
+	// Construct custom command parsers
+	CMMFAudioPlayDeviceCustomCommandParser* audPlayDevParser = CMMFAudioPlayDeviceCustomCommandParser::NewL(*this);
+	CleanupStack::PushL(audPlayDevParser);
+	AddCustomCommandParserL(*audPlayDevParser); //parser now owned by controller framework
+	CleanupStack::Pop();//audPlayDevParser
+
+	CMMFAudioRecordDeviceCustomCommandParser* audRecDevParser = CMMFAudioRecordDeviceCustomCommandParser::NewL(*this);
+	CleanupStack::PushL(audRecDevParser);
+	AddCustomCommandParserL(*audRecDevParser); //parser now owned by controller framework
+	CleanupStack::Pop();//audRecDevParser
+
+etc.
+	}
+@endcode
+
+@since 7.0s
+*/
+class CMMFAudioPlayDeviceCustomCommandParser : public CMMFCustomCommandParserBase
+	{
+public:
+
+	/**
+	Creates a new custom command parser capable of handling audio play device commands.
+
+	This function may leave with one of the system-wide error codes.
+
+	@param  aImplementor
+	        A reference to the controller plugin that owns this new object.
+
+	@return	A pointer to the object created.
+
+	@since  7.0s
+	*/
+	IMPORT_C static CMMFAudioPlayDeviceCustomCommandParser* NewL(MMMFAudioPlayDeviceCustomCommandImplementor& aImplementor);
+
+	/**
+	Destructor.
+
+	@since  7.0s
+	*/
+	IMPORT_C ~CMMFAudioPlayDeviceCustomCommandParser();
+
+	/**
+	Handles a request from the client. Called by the controller framework.
+
+	@param  aMessage
+	        The message to be handled.
+
+	@since  7.0s
+	*/
+	void HandleRequest(TMMFMessage& aMessage);
+private:
+
+	/**
+	Constructor.
+
+	@param  aImplementor
+	        A reference to the controller plugin that owns this new object.
+
+	@since	7.0s
+	*/
+	CMMFAudioPlayDeviceCustomCommandParser(MMMFAudioPlayDeviceCustomCommandImplementor& aImplementor);
+	// Internal request handling methods.
+	void DoHandleRequestL(TMMFMessage& aMessage);
+	TBool DoSetVolumeL(TMMFMessage& aMessage);
+	TBool DoGetMaxVolumeL(TMMFMessage& aMessage);
+	TBool DoGetVolumeL(TMMFMessage& aMessage);
+	TBool DoSetVolumeRampL(TMMFMessage& aMessage);
+	TBool DoSetBalanceL(TMMFMessage& aMessage);
+	TBool DoGetBalanceL(TMMFMessage& aMessage);
+private:
+	/** The object that implements the audio play device interface */
+	MMMFAudioPlayDeviceCustomCommandImplementor& iImplementor;
+	};

+/**
+@publishedAll
+@released
+
+Client class to access functionality specific to a video playback controller.
+
+The class uses the custom command function of the controller plugin, and removes the necessity
+for the client to formulate the custom commands.
+
+@since  7.0s
+*/
+class RMMFVideoPlayControllerCustomCommands : public RMMFCustomCommandsBase
+	{
+public:
+
+	/**
+	Constructor.
+
+	@param  aController
+	        The client side controller object to be used by this custom command interface.
+
+	@since  7.0s
+	*/
+	IMPORT_C RMMFVideoPlayControllerCustomCommands(RMMFController& aController);
+
+	/**
+	Prepares the video clip to be accessed.
+
+	A call to this function tells the loaded controller plugin to finalise its configuration
+	and to prepare to start reading the video clip.  It is not possible to play the video clip
+	or query any of its properties (e.g. duration, meta data etc.) until the controller plugin
+	has signified the completion of this method by generating a KMMFEventCategoryVideoPrepareComplete
+	event.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t Prepare();
+
+	/**
+	Asks the controller to store the current frame to a bitmap. 
+
+	The video play controller will send an event to the client on completion of the task.
+
+	@param  aBitmap
+	        The handle of the CFbsBitmap object to retrieve the frame to.
+	@param  aStatus
+	        The active object to call back on.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C void GetFrame(CFbsBitmap& aBitmap, TRequestStatus& aStatus);
+
+	/**
+	Sets the screen region to be used to display the video.
+
+	@param  aWindowRect
+	        The window rectangle.
+	@param  aClipRect
+	        The clip rectangle.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t SetDisplayWindow(const TRect& aWindowRect, const TRect& aClipRect) const;
+
+	/**
+	Updates the display region.
+
+	@param  aRegion
+	        The valid region to display to.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t UpdateDisplayRegion(const TRegion& aRegion) const;
+
+	/**
+	Queries whether audio is enabled.
+
+	@param  aEnabled
+	        A boolean indicating whether audio is enabled.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t GetAudioEnabled(TBool& aEnabled) const;
+
+	/**
+	Sends a direct screen access event to controller.
+
+	@param  aDSAEvent
+	        The direct screen access event.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t DirectScreenAccessEvent(const TMMFDSAEvent aDSAEvent) const;
+
+	/**
+ 	Sets a time window for video playback.
+
+ 	@param  aStart
+	        The start time in milliseconds relative to the start of the video clip.
+  	@param  aEnd
+	        The end time in milliseconds relative to the start of the video clip.
+
+  	@return One of the system-wide error codes.
+
+  	@since  7.0s
+	*/
+	IMPORT_C TInt Play(const TTimeIntervalMicroSeconds& aStart, const TTimeIntervalMicroSeconds& aEnd) const;
+
+	/**
+  	Requests the controller to redraw the current frame.
+
+  	@return One of the system-wide error codes.
+
+  	@since  7.0s
+	*/
+	IMPORT_C TInt RefreshFrame() const;
+
+	/**
+	Gets the video loading progress as a percentage.
+
+	@param  aPercentageProgress
+	        The progress loading the clip, as a percentage.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t GetLoadingProgress(TInt& aPercentageProgress) const;
+
+	/**
+	Rotates the video image on the screen.
+
+	@param  aRotation
+	        The desired rotation to apply.
+
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t SetRotation(TVideoRotation aRotation) const;
+
+	/**
+	Queries the rotation that is currently applied to the video image.
+
+	@param  aRotation
+	        The applied rotation.
+
+	@return One of the system w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t GetRotation(TVideoRotation& aRotation) const;
+
+	/**
+	Scales the video image to a specified percentage of its original size.
+
+	@param  aWidthPercentage
+	        The percentage (100 = original size) to be used to scale the width of the video image.
+	@param  aHeightPercentage
+	        The percentage (100 = original size) to be used to scale the height of the video image. 
+	        If this is not equal to aWidthPercentage then the image may be distorted.
+	@param  aAntiAliasFiltering
+	        True if anti-aliasing filtering should be used. If the plugin does not
+	        support this kind of processing, this value will be ignored.
+
+	@return One of the system wide error codes.
+
+	@since 7.0s
+	*/
+	IMPORT_C TInt SetScaleFactor(TReal32 aWidthPercentage, TReal32 aHeightPercentage, TBool aAntiAliasFiltering) const;
+
+	/**
+	Gets the scale factor currently applied to the video image.
+
+	@param  aWidthPercentage
+	        On return, will contain the percentage (100 = original size) used to scale the width
+	        of the video image.
+	@param  aHeightPercentage
+	        On return. will contain the percentage (100 = original size) used to scale the height 
+	        of the video image.
+	@param  aAntiAliasFiltering
+	        True if anti-aliasing filtering is being used
+
+	@return One of the system w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t GetScaleFactor(TReal32& aWidthPercentage, TReal32& aHeightPercentage, TBool& aAntiAliasFiltering) const;
+
+	/**
+	Selects a region of the video image to be displayed.
+
+	@param  aCropRegion
+	        The dimensions of the crop region, relative to the video image.
+
+	@return One of the system wide error codes.
+
+	@since 7.0s
+	*/
+	IMPORT_C TInt SetCropRegion(const TRect& aCropRegion) const;
+
+	/**
+	Gets the crop region currently applied to the image.
+
+	@param  aCropRegion
+	        The dimensions of the crop region, relative to the video image. If no crop region has
+	        been applied, the full dimensions of the video image will be returned.
+	
+	@return One of the system-wide error codes.
+
+	@since  7.0s
+	*/
+	IMPORT_C TInt GetCropRegion(TRect& aCropRegion) const;
+
+
+private:
+	TPckgBuf<TMMFVideoConfig> iConfigPackage;
+	};

+/**
+@publishedPartner
+@released
+
+Mixin class to be derived from by controller plugins that could support the set repeats custom command.
+*/
+class MMMFAudioPlayControllerSetRepeatsCustomCommandImplementor
+	{
+public:
+
+	/**
+	Sets the number of times the audio sample is to be repeated during the playback operation.	
+	A period of silence can follow each playing of the sample. The audio sample can be repeated indefinitely.
+	
+	@param	aRepeatNumberOfTimes
+    		The number of times the audio sample, together with the trailing silence, is to be repeated. 
+    		If this is set to KMdaRepeatForever, then the audio sample, together with the trailing silence, 
+    		is repeated indefinitely or until Stop() is called. 
+    		If this is set to zero, then the audio sample is not repeated.
+	
+	@param  aTrailingSilence
+         	The time interval of the trailing silence in microseconds.
+	
+	@return	KErrNone if the controller plugin supports the loop play functionality
+			KErrNotSupported if the controller plugin does not support the loop play functionality
+			KErrNotReady if the controller plugin is not yet added the audio sink
+	*/		
+	virtual TInt MapcSetRepeats(TInt aRepeatNumberOfTimes, const TTimeIntervalMicroSeconds& aTrailingSilence) = 0;		
+	};
